It emphasises how little people understand in terms of what is actually needed to be a good 9.
A bit of flash and some dogged defence is enough for those that don’t understand how a 9 effects the timing of the rest of your attack. And that’s not to say Dwyer always messes it up, but his inconsistency has, for me, become as infuriating as his lack of decision making. I suppose what I mean by that is if he played the same as the other week when he started I could have seen him still being here.

| FB must be a very different place to here. I don't know how you can watch RL for years and not understand the importance of good service from dummy half.
Dwyer has cleaned up his distribution a fair bit since being dropped, but he still lapses and I suspect always will under pressure. He will also occasionally win games from the bench, as he's clearly a real threat when running.
Under Agar that combination meant him getting more and more game time. Under Smith he's been usurped by someone who had never played hooker but can pass and has a rugby brain. I think its fairly clear who better understands the way a good team works.....
